## Runbook — Retention Sweeper (Cindervault)

The sweeper runs nightly at 02:10 and deletes records past their retention class in the Cindervault archive. If the sweep exceeds four hours, it self-terminates and resumes the next night; this is expected, not a failure. Do not re-run manually during business hours, as it contends with the export jobs. After any manual invocation, log the run's trace token below.

pipeline stamp: htk31_f769b577b3028a4e9958e5bb8d1259a

Scheduler constants for the Fernloft watering daemon. Intervals are in minutes; moisture thresholds are raw sensor units, not percent. Changing the poll interval below the debounce window will double-fire the pump relay — reviewer, please check that invariant holds if these are edited. Seasonal offsets are applied upstream, so these values assume baseline greenhouse conditions at the Dellbrook test site. The constants follow.

tuning table, kajog-bawip:
TIERS = {
    "kelius": 256,
    "lammir": 543,
}

### Checklist: Cross-service tracing

- Verify trace headers propagate through the Gatefold gateway into billing, ledger, and notify services.
- Confirm span sampling rate matches the release plan (1%).
- Run the synthetic checkout flow and confirm a single unbroken trace in Spanlark.
- No orphan spans in the last smoke run.

Release manager: record sign-off only against the verified artifact shown below:

trace token, kawip-fafog: htk14_26e64c4d35154e

# AgriLink Gateway — Environments

AgriLink ingests telemetry from tractors and irrigation rigs. Three environments: dev (shared, resets nightly), staging (mirrors prod topology, synthetic device fleet), and prod (do not touch without a change ticket). Each environment has its own broker and credentials; never point a dev device at prod. Promotion goes dev → staging → prod via the Fieldgate pipeline. Staging runs with the configuration shown below.

deployment values, fafog-fawip:
[jorox]
team = fendor
access_code = ac_bb00ea
host = jorox.qorveltech.internal
port = 9200
owner = istdor.aldeth
peer = julvan.orvexlabs.internal